July 29, 2024鈥(Ottawa) 鈥 Today the Stem Cell Network (SCN) is pleased to announce planned for SCN鈥檚 2025-2029 funding cycle.聽This new competition will support world-class, translational, regenerative medicine research, across the research continuum to facilitate health, social and economic benefits for Canadians.聽
The competition will officially open on鈥疶uesday, September 3, 2024,鈥痑nd offers 24- and 36-month awards.聽聽
Six regenerative medicine research programs are available that focus on innovation, clinical translation, policy and societal impact and commercialization.聽
- Accelerating Clinical Translation Awards (up to鈥$650,000): To support鈥痬ulti-disciplinary research that is moving towards the clinic within five years; or is addressing a key research question associated with an ongoing clinical trial.聽
- Clinical Trial Awards (up to鈥$1,100,000): To support early-stage clinical trial projects with high translational potential.聽
- Early Career Researcher Jump Start Awards (up to鈥$350,000): For early career researchers (within the first five years of an initial academic appointment) to develop a research program with a regenerative medicine focus.聽
- Fueling Biotechnology Partnerships Awards (up to鈥$430,000): To support academic partnerships with emerging Canadian regenerative medicine biotechnology companies to bring innovative technologies or therapies to the clinic or market.聽
- Impact Awards (up to鈥$270,000): To support proof-of-principle experiments, including novel therapeutic or technical approach development that will drive regenerative medicine therapies forward.聽
- Impact Awards: ELSI & HE Stream鈥(up to鈥$215,000): To support the knowledge generation and/or translation of regenerative medicine research for targeted stakeholders and/or users.聽
